Pastor Colin reminds us that our hope isn’t tethered to circumstances or creeds, but rooted in the living presence of Jesus Christ, who died and rose again. This is what sets Christianity apart.

Pastor Colin takes us through 1 Corinthians 15, exploring the transformative grace that Jesus offers. Grace that not only redeems us from our past sins but also energises us for our present callings. As we listen, we’re invited to consider the unique hope found in a relationship with Jesus—one that brings redemption, strength, and a glorious future.
